Safe Hideout Falsehoods: Differentiating Reality from Fabrication in Fortified Space Design
Many think that shelter design is as simple as creating a hole underground and installing a steel door. Unfortunately, this widespread notion promotes several dangerous myths. For example , the idea that any waterproof membrane will sufficiently protect against water damage is often incorrect . Similarly, the assumption that a single air filter can ensure breathable air for an extended period during a hazardous event is improbable . Careful assessment of ventilation, electricity sources, waste handling, and structural soundness are absolutely essential, and relying on untested advice can literally be a question of life or safety. In conclusion , informed bunker design necessitates more than basic construction; it involves a detailed understanding of the potential threats and the engineering principles involved.

Debunked: Common Misconceptions About Subterranean Secure Shelters
Many believe that creating an subterranean hideout guarantees complete safety during a crisis . However, several common inaccuracies encircle this notion . For instance , the thought that excavating deep enough automatically provides protection from every dangers is just incorrect . Groundwater penetration, building collapse , and breathing difficulties are real risks often ignored . Furthermore, the idea that below-ground locations are impervious to discovery by personnel is also largely inaccurate. Sufficient identifying technology exists and can readily find hidden structures .
